    A patent is an exclusive right to the inventor's property. It excludes others from manufacturing, reproducing, and selling your invention for a set period of time. There are three types of patents and they last for different time periods. Once the prescribed time elapses, the patent expires and the invention becomes public domain. In order to apply for a patent, you contact the Patent Office and get the necessary application. There are fees you must pay when you submit your application and, and they may be quite costly. Therefore, you must be serious about your invention before you proceed further with it. There is no guarantee whatsoever that you will get a patent for your product even when you have applied for one. As soon as your application is sent to the Patent Office, it will be thoroughly examined by them. If your invention passes all of their scrutiny, and is found to be an original creation, and, you have paid all of the necessary fees, then your patent will be granted. But, on the other hand, if the Patent Office finds similarities in your invention versus an already patented invention, you may be required to change your invention. Anyone can obtain a patent, as long as their invention is not too close in structure, or, is not too similar to another invention that has already been patented. Your invention must be new, and not just a spin-off of another patented product.

      There are basically three different types of patent that you can apply for. They are either a utility patent, a design patent, or a plant patent. In order to get a patent you have to simply get in touch with the patent office and fill in all the required applications. You will also be required to pay in a certain amount of fees. The fees are generally very expensive, so do think about your patent before you plan to get a license for it. Once you send a patent it will thoroughly be scrutinized as to whether your invention deserves a patent. Incase your invention turns out to be similar to other products you will need to make alterations or changes as desired.
